Output 93c809ad121fc42dc0857c1de4e0d170b17ff9ade3f24cc9449673d109ab30dc:3

value
28985973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5f204a712cf0114cb0ba7f73881dda4c73cd2e8 OP_EQUAL
address
MRwoGwNohbbfryZkmfuKQhpoHKcMm7hJ5p
transaction
93c809ad121fc42dc0857c1de4e0d170b17ff9ade3f24cc9449673d109ab30dc
spent
true